Feminist Theory
For the most part, claims that patriarchy is at least as important as class inequality in determining a person’s opportunities in life. It holds that male domination and female subordination are determined not by biological necessity but by structures of power and social convention. It examines the operation of patriarchy in both micro and macro settings. And it contends that existing patterns of gender inequality can and should be changed for the benefit of all members of society.
Emotions
Complex psychological states that involve three distinct components: a subjective experience, a physiological response, and a behavioral or expressive response.
Empathy
The ability to understand and share the feelings of another person.
Social Interaction
The process by which individuals act and react in relation to others, forming the basis of social relationships and society.
